I'm doing very well thanks ajpbf7. Here's the information that you're looking for.
 
Acura's May buy rate lease money factor and residual value for a 36-month lease of a 2012 TSX Base with 10,000 miles per year are .00046 and 59%, respectively for consumers who qualify for its top aka "Super Preferred" credit tier.
 
The numbers for an otherwise identical lease of a '12 TSX SE are the same.
